Winter 2012 Adult Education
Serious Answers to Hard Questions” Discussion Series - Ten Christian and Jewish theologians, world experts in their respective fields, were each asked to address a single perplexing issue, such as Religion & Science, Other Religions, Evangelism & Tolerance, The God of the Old Testament, The Gnostic Gospels, and Sins of the Church. The result is the “Serious Answers” course, which will encourage energetic discussion and sustained reflection by both believers and seekers. This DVD series will be the centerpiece of Adult Education on Sunday mornings (10:00 AM) and Wednesday evenings (6:30 PM), with a different topic at each session. Facilitated by Evan Hansen and Pastor Nelson. Begins Sunday, January 8.

On Lenten Sundays beginning February 26, we will begin a education series on “Christians and Vocation.” People sometimes assume that some jobs or lifestyles are automatically better in God’s eyes and people who are soldiers or police officers or firefighters or preachers have higher purpose and value to God and to the rest of us. Yet, a proper understanding of Christian and vocation is believing and trusting that God is working through your daily life, calling you to “bloom where you’re planted,” and that meaning is found in serving God by serving the neighbor, being a good spouse, child, parent, employee, employer, and citizen. Throughout Lent, Sunday Adult Education will welcome Peace members sharing where faith and vocation come together for them.
